摘要

sensor to measure the fraction of water in a fluid mixture in a conductive pipe inside a borehole, production control system of a production zone of a hydrocarbon well, method of measuring a fraction of water in a flowing fluid mixture in a conductive pipe inside a borehole, and application of a sensor method to measure the fraction of water in a fluid mixture in a conductive pipe inside a borehole. the sensor comprises: an active probe, a reference probe, and an electronic unit. the active probe comprises a first electrode and a second electrode mutually isolated by a first insulating layer, the first and second electrodes are preferably in contact with the fluid mixture. the reference probe is formed from an internal wall of the conducting pipe that contacts the fluid mixture and isolated from the reference probe by a second insulating layer. the electronic unit is coupled to the first and second electrodes, and to the reference probe, the electronic unit preferably includes a capacitance module to measure a capacitance between the active probe and the reference probe.
